Staging a home is vital to making a magnetic ambiance that attracts attention in real estate photography. It portrays the home's best features, making it even more inviting to potential buyers. Here are a few top home staging tips you can use for real estate photography.

1. De-clutter:

Creating an impression of an spacious and open property begins with de-cluttering. This action plays a key role in illustrating the true dimensions of the home. Ensure that surfaces are clean and arranged, personal items are removed, and the quantity of furniture in every room is diminished.

Next, Illuminate:

Great lighting creates a warm, inviting atmosphere that buyers love. Increase natural light by raising curtains and blinds and cutting back any external bushes or trees blocking light. Also, install artificial lighting where necessary to brighten spaces.

3. Color Balance:

A soft color spectrum can result in a calming and sophisticated environment. Refrain from bright colors, as they tend to cause distractions and may not photograph well.

Lastly, Don't Forget the Exterior:

Curb appeal is crucial; therefore, focus on the exterior of the property as well. Make sure that the lawn is manicured, repair any noticeable damages, and store unsightly objects like garbage cans or hoses.

By following these home staging tips, you'll be well on your way to producing real estate photography that wows potential buyers and supports in selling your property faster.
